What is Banco BBVA Argentina Net Income (Continuing Operations)?

Net Income (Continuing Operations) indicates the net income that a firm brings in from ongoing business activities. These activities are expected to continue into the next reporting period. Banco BBVA Argentina's Net Income (Continuing Operations) for the three months ended in Mar. 2024 was ARS34,151 Mil. Its Net Income (Continuing Operations) for the trailing twelve months (TTM) ended in Mar. 2024 was ARS155,770 Mil.

Banco BBVA Argentina  (BUE:BBAR) Net Income (Continuing Operations) Explanation

Net Income (Continuing Operations) excludes extraordinary items, income from the cumulative effects of accounting changes, non-recurring items, income from tax loss carry forward, and preferred dividends.

Banco BBVA Argentina SA is a banking services provider in Argentina. It provides financial assistance to large corporations, small and medium-sized companies, as well as individuals. It bank provides services through retail, corporate, investment banking, and Small and medium-sized companies divisions. Through the retail banking segment, it provides banking products and services to individuals, corporate banking deals with services to corporates, and the small and medium-sized companies segment focused on foreign trade, agricultural business, and digital products. Its geographical segments are Spain, the United States, Mexico, Turkey, South America, and the Rest of Eurasia.
